    Are you ensuring that your secret ID is the same as well as your regular ID?
    It checks for OT name, gender, ID, and SID.

    Ok dude you to do two things here...
    A) calm down and focus on the Pokesav screen
    B) lay off of COM like evandixon says

    Ok now focus: You need to put in your Trainer name, EXACTLY as it is in the game, your ID and SID numbers, your Trainer Gender is set correctly. Also, the Region/Version has to be put to the correct one and the language of the game set it to English if you are playing an English language game.
    Try that and see if it works. If you have done this and it still isn't working then try using PokeGen instead, its simple and always makes the pokemon correctly.
